- What is Griffon's inventories?
- Griffon (GFF) reported inventories of $185.53M in Q2 2026.
- How has Griffon's inventories changed year-over-year?
- Griffon's inventories decreased by 58.4% year-over-year, from $445.91M to $185.53M.
- What is the long-term trend for Griffon's inventories?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Griffon's inventories has grown at a -22.4%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$472.79M to $171.75M.
- What does inventories mean?
- Total inventory including raw materials, work-in-progress, and finished goods, valued at the lower of cost or net realizable value.
